Entspannen Sie auf dem Deck, der Terrasse oder am Strand und beobachten Sie die Delfine, die in den Wellen tummeln.
Diese luxuriöse Wohnanlage in der 1. Etage am Meer verfügt über eine private Terrasse, eine Terrasse und einen Strand mit spektakulärem Blick auf die Skyline von San Diego und die Coronado-Inseln. Private Schritte bringen Sie zu den Sandstränden mit dem Pazifischen Ozean innerhalb weniger Meter. Das Hotel liegt nur wenige Minuten von allen Veranstaltungsorten in San Diego entfernt.

My three daughters and I had a wonderful week at this location. On the plus side, the place is really big. Lots of room inside and a nice deck right outside the sliding doors. The view is awesome. We saw dolphins every day. We picked the wrong week for the weather because it was overcast every day except one. Even with that, the sun broke thru for several hours a day and it was warm enough to leave the doors and windows open all the time. Having been born and raised in Imperial Beach, I knew this weather was unusual. Just bad luck. My daughters walked the beach every day collecting shells and enjoying the beach. The little restaurants nearby were awesome, especially the little Mexican place with the flags and outside seating. The food was wonderful. We loved our place and our time together in Imperial Beach. We didn't get to meet Alex in person but he was available by phone or text. We had to have a repair and he got it done very quickly. On the minus side: 1. There was only 1 trash bag in the kitchen and no spares. Also one roll of paper towels. We had to buy those items. I know it sounds picky but for what I paid, I expected everything to be supplied. 2. The intercom was broken and the electric outlets in both bathrooms did not work. (Alex got them fixed immediately). 3. Sad to say, I could not get to the beach from our patio access because there is no path along the rocks in the picture. You have to climb over those rocks and I have a bad knee that prevents me from doing any steps or stairs without a handrail. There is a public access a short way down Seacoast and I do think we could have gotten extra supplies with just a phone call to Alex who got the outlets fixed right away. There is also an elevator in the building which takes you right to your door. Lastly: I was never given a unit number, just the street address and you need the unit number to know which lockbox is yours. Since I rented this place through HomeAway, I don't think this was the owners fault. You do not get the lock box number till the day before which is totally understandable but I NEVER got the unit number. When we arrived we had to try the code on all the boxes to see which was ours and I think the other owner thought we were a bit sketchy as he asked which unit we were in and we didn't know. That was a bit uncomfortable. The HomeAway says 1 bathroom. There are 2. All in all, it was a great vacation and a really beautiful location for our stay. I recommend it.

Jun 2019
This was our second time back to this same property. Last year’s trip went so well and was so relaxing that we decided to repeat the process. We were not disappointed. The kids enjoyed it as well since SeaWorld and the Birch aquarium were on the agenda. There is so much to do whether you want to walk along the beach to the pier and get ice cream or hop in the car for a multitude of fun things for the kids and Mom and Dad within about 30-40 minutes drive time. There’s no shortage of things to do in San Diego. But if you don’t want the crowds, this place at Imperial Beach is a wonderfully calm and quiet area where you can just enjoy the sounds of the ocean surf. I highly recommend this place. I should also mention that if you’ve been busy all day and are tired when dinner time rolls around Grubhub delivers to this place. There were a couple of nights where we just ordered out and had food delivered. There’s a large grocery store about 10 minutes away so stocking the kitchen was easy as well. Everything else was provided. Plates, bowls, cookware, utensils, beach towels, shower towels, linens, pillows, shampoo, soap, paper towel, beach toys, boogie boards, beach chairs and a beach umbrella. There’s even a gas grill there if you want to grill out. Truly all you need to bring is your clothes and personal stuff. It makes for light traveling. The place is very clean and well taken care of. We were sad to leave.
